import $ from 'jquery';
import _ from 'lodash';
import * as opensearch from '../opensearch/opensearch';
// NOTE: If this value ever changes to be a few seconds or less, it might introduce flakiness
// due to timing issues in our app.js tests.
const POLL_INTERVAL = 60000;
let pollTimeoutId;
let perIndexTypes = {};
let perAliasIndexes = [];
let templates = [];
const mappingObj = {};
export function expandAliases(indicesOrAliases) {
// takes a list of indices or aliases or a string which may be either and returns a list of indices
// returns a list for multiple values or a string for a single.
if (!indicesOrAliases) {
return indicesOrAliases;
}
if (typeof indicesOrAliases === 'string') {
indicesOrAliases = [indicesOrAliases];
}
indicesOrAliases = $.map(indicesOrAliases, function (iOrA) {
if (perAliasIndexes[iOrA]) {
return perAliasIndexes[iOrA];
}
return [iOrA];
});
let ret = [].concat.apply([], indicesOrAliases);
ret.sort();
let last;
ret = $.map(ret, function (v) {
const r = last === v ? null : v;
last = v;
return r;
});
return ret.length > 1 ? ret : ret[0];
}
export function getTemplates() {
return [...templates];
}
export function getFields(indices, types) {
// get fields for indices and types. Both can be a list, a string or null (meaning all).
let ret = [];
indices = expandAliases(indices);
if (typeof indices === 'string') {
const typeDict = perIndexTypes[indices];
if (!typeDict) {
return [];
}
if (typeof types === 'string') {
const f = typeDict[types];
ret = f ? f : [];
} else {
// filter what we need
$.each(typeDict, function (type, fields) {
if (!types || types.length === 0 || $.inArray(type, types) !== -1) {
ret.push(fields);
}
});
ret = [].concat.apply([], ret);
}
} else {
// multi index mode.
$.each(perIndexTypes, function (index) {
if (!indices || indices.length === 0 || $.inArray(index, indices) !== -1) {
ret.push(getFields(index, types));
}
});
ret = [].concat.apply([], ret);
}
return _.uniqBy(ret, function (f) {
return f.name + ':' + f.type;
});
}
export function getTypes(indices) {
let ret = [];
indices = expandAliases(indices);
if (typeof indices === 'string') {
const typeDict = perIndexTypes[indices];
if (!typeDict) {
return [];
}
// filter what we need
$.each(typeDict, function (type) {
ret.push(type);
});
} else {
// multi index mode.
$.each(perIndexTypes, function (index) {
if (!indices || $.inArray(index, indices) !== -1) {
ret.push(getTypes(index));
}
});
ret = [].concat.apply([], ret);
}
return _.uniq(ret);
}
export function getIndices(includeAliases) {
const ret = [];
$.each(perIndexTypes, function (index) {
ret.push(index);
});
if (typeof includeAliases === 'undefined' ? true : includeAliases) {
$.each(perAliasIndexes, function (alias) {
ret.push(alias);
});
}
return ret;
}
function getFieldNamesFromFieldMapping(fieldName, fieldMapping) {
if (fieldMapping.enabled === false) {
return [];
}
let nestedFields;
function applyPathSettings(nestedFieldNames) {
const pathType = fieldMapping.path || 'full';
if (pathType === 'full') {
return $.map(nestedFieldNames, function (f) {
f.name = fieldName + '.' + f.name;
return f;
});
}
return nestedFieldNames;
}
if (fieldMapping.properties) {
// derived object type
nestedFields = getFieldNamesFromProperties(fieldMapping.properties);
return applyPathSettings(nestedFields);
}
const fieldType = fieldMapping.type;
const ret = { name: fieldName, type: fieldType };
if (fieldMapping.index_name) {
ret.name = fieldMapping.index_name;
}
if (fieldMapping.fields) {
nestedFields = $.map(fieldMapping.fields, function (fieldMapping, fieldName) {
return getFieldNamesFromFieldMapping(fieldName, fieldMapping);
});
nestedFields = applyPathSettings(nestedFields);
nestedFields.unshift(ret);
return nestedFields;
}
return [ret];
}
function getFieldNamesFromProperties(properties = {}) {
const fieldList = $.map(properties, function (fieldMapping, fieldName) {
return getFieldNamesFromFieldMapping(fieldName, fieldMapping);
});
// deduping
return _.uniqBy(fieldList, function (f) {
return f.name + ':' + f.type;
});
}
function loadTemplates(templatesObject = {}) {
templates = Object.keys(templatesObject);
}
export function loadMappings(mappings) {
perIndexTypes = {};
$.each(mappings, function (index, indexMapping) {
const normalizedIndexMappings = {};
// Migrate 1.0.0 mappings. This format has changed, so we need to extract the underlying mapping.
if (indexMapping.mappings && _.keys(indexMapping).length === 1) {
indexMapping = indexMapping.mappings;
}
$.each(indexMapping, function (typeName, typeMapping) {
if (typeName === 'properties') {
const fieldList = getFieldNamesFromProperties(typeMapping);
normalizedIndexMappings[typeName] = fieldList;
} else {
normalizedIndexMappings[typeName] = [];
}
});
perIndexTypes[index] = normalizedIndexMappings;
});
}
export function loadAliases(aliases) {
perAliasIndexes = {};
$.each(aliases || {}, function (index, omdexAliases) {
// verify we have an index defined. useful when mapping loading is disabled
perIndexTypes[index] = perIndexTypes[index] || {};
$.each(omdexAliases.aliases || {}, function (alias) {
if (alias === index) {
return;
} // alias which is identical to index means no index.
let curAliases = perAliasIndexes[alias];
if (!curAliases) {
curAliases = [];
perAliasIndexes[alias] = curAliases;
}
curAliases.push(index);
});
});
perAliasIndexes._all = getIndices(false);
}
export function clear() {
perIndexTypes = {};
perAliasIndexes = {};
templates = [];
}
function retrieveSettings(settingsKey, settingsToRetrieve) {
const settingKeyToPathMap = {
fields: '_mapping',
indices: '_aliases',
templates: '_template',
};
// Fetch autocomplete info if setting is set to true, and if user has made changes.
if (settingsToRetrieve[settingsKey] === true) {
return opensearch.send('GET', settingKeyToPathMap[settingsKey], null);
} else {
const settingsPromise = new $.Deferred();
if (settingsToRetrieve[settingsKey] === false) {
// If the user doesn't want autocomplete suggestions, then clear any that exist
return settingsPromise.resolveWith(this, [[JSON.stringify({})]]);
} else {
// If the user doesn't want autocomplete suggestions, then clear any that exist
return settingsPromise.resolve();
}
}
}
// Retrieve all selected settings by default.
// TODO: We should refactor this to be easier to consume. Ideally this function should retrieve
// whatever settings are specified, otherwise just use the saved settings. This requires changing
// the behavior to not *clear* whatever settings have been unselected, but it's hard to tell if
// this is possible without altering the autocomplete behavior. These are the scenarios we need to
// support:
// 1. Manual refresh. Specify what we want. Fetch specified, leave unspecified alone.
// 2. Changed selection and saved: Specify what we want. Fetch changed and selected, leave
// unchanged alone (both selected and unselected).
// 3. Poll: Use saved. Fetch selected. Ignore unselected.
export function clearSubscriptions() {
if (pollTimeoutId) {
clearTimeout(pollTimeoutId);
}
}
/**
*
* @param settings Settings A way to retrieve the current settings
* @param settingsToRetrieve any
*/
export function retrieveAutoCompleteInfo(settings, settingsToRetrieve) {
clearSubscriptions();
const mappingPromise = retrieveSettings('fields', settingsToRetrieve);
const aliasesPromise = retrieveSettings('indices', settingsToRetrieve);
const templatesPromise = retrieveSettings('templates', settingsToRetrieve);
$.when(mappingPromise, aliasesPromise, templatesPromise).done((mappings, aliases, templates) => {
let mappingsResponse;
if (mappings) {
const maxMappingSize = mappings[0].length > 10 * 1024 * 1024;
if (maxMappingSize) {
console.warn(
`Mapping size is larger than 10MB (${mappings[0].length / 1024 / 1024} MB). Ignoring...`
);
mappingsResponse = '[{}]';
} else {
mappingsResponse = mappings[0];
}
loadMappings(JSON.parse(mappingsResponse));
}
if (aliases) {
loadAliases(JSON.parse(aliases[0]));
}
if (templates) {
loadTemplates(JSON.parse(templates[0]));
}
if (mappings && aliases) {
// Trigger an update event with the mappings, aliases
$(mappingObj).trigger('update', [mappingsResponse, aliases[0]]);
}
// Schedule next request.
pollTimeoutId = setTimeout(() => {
// This looks strange/inefficient, but it ensures correct behavior because we don't want to send
// a scheduled request if the user turns off polling.
if (settings.getPolling()) {
retrieveAutoCompleteInfo(settings, settings.getAutocomplete());
}
}, POLL_INTERVAL);
});
}
